What part will you play?
This Service Delivery Manager (SDM) be responsible for successfully representing and leading highly talented On-Site Media Support Teams. The SDM will manage on-site team personnel and act as a liaison to Diversified to ensure the employee feels part of Diversified while working on site daily at client location.
What will you be doing?
Manage U. S. On Site Workplace/Media team personnel and act as liaison between the client and Diversified ensuring that employees feel they are part of Diversified while still working every day at client site.
Responsible for the fulfillment of the client SOW requirements, as it relates to the talents and skills needed to deliver. Responsible for delivery of services with On Site personnel. Interview, and place candidates for Service clients. Write and modify job descriptions, post, interview for skills and fit.
Collaborate with internal stakeholders and customers to create standards for employee onboarding to deliver committed On Site Services.
Ensure employee logistics, set client expectations, hours of operations and manage overtime and billing. Oversee onboarding activities such as badging, security requirements, etc.
Develop training plans to ensure team members are meeting their KPIs within client needs and committed SOW. Manage overall SLA compliance for service to monitor and track performance.
Manage and Schedule operations to Ensure action items are being administered/performed timely and efficiently.
Provide expertise in transforming client requirements into actionable operational trackable deliverables, be the Central point of reporting for service-related activity across the enterprise.
SDM will provide insight/reporting of onsite activities. Host Bi-weekly, Monthly and Quarterly Business Reviews (QBRs) to present our SLAs, overall project(s) status, next quarter focus, areas that need attention.
Develop ways for onsite team to track metrics of the event production team in scheduling, forecasting, and reporting on capacity planning for both people and equipment requirements
Identify needs and support creation of team structure as Services expands (supervisors, managers, team leads). Specific metrics such as number of meeting requests, break-fix cases and A/V room sweeps including client user survey comments are pulled from the client ticketing system and AV dashboards to show performance statistics for all Diversified AV technicians as well as all client sites with AV case requests globally.
Ensure client satisfaction is maintained.
Ensure proper accounting of resources, bill rates, utilization and tracking is in place.
Provide insight, coaching and professional development to team to enhance knowledge and technical skills. Employee development and mentoring of professional goals for individual contributors.
Contract Management for Internal Diversified Coordination & Deliverables.
Risk Management and Issue tracking.
